小编sdf*_*sdf的帖子

SWT浏览器,在显示之前更改内容

我希望在向用户显示之前更改SWT浏览器的内容(由用户定义的某些网页).当我说改变时,我的意思是添加几个css/js文件到HTML代码.

我尝试使用ProgressListener用于此目的(我使用getText()获取所有代码,进行一些更改并应用setText()方法),但发现在这种情况下,没有绝对路径定义的所有其他资源都不再可用.

它发生了,因为在setText()浏览器将页面设置为about:blank之后.所以,我有所有代码,但所有使用相对路径定义的css/js/img都不再可用.

是否可以添加几行css/js定义,而不是松散所有没有相对路径的资源?

提前致谢!

java browser swt

4
推荐指数
1
解决办法
6622
查看次数

标签 统计

browser ×1

java ×1

swt ×1